Sleep Tracking: What Wearables Can and Cannot Tell You About Sleep

Consumer trackers are useful for trends and misleading for single nights. How to interpret your sleep data sensibly.

What consumer trackers actually measure

Wrist and ring devices do not measure brain activity. They infer sleep from movement, heart rate, heart-rate variability and sometimes temperature and blood oxygen estimates. Algorithms then translate those signals into stages. That inference is reasonable for detecting whether you were asleep, and much weaker for deciding which stage you were in.

Where accuracy is decent

Most modern devices are reasonably good at estimating total sleep time and bedtime consistency, and they can flag broad trends: later bedtimes across a busy month, worse recovery after alcohol, more awakenings during a stressful period. Those trends are where the practical value lies.

Where accuracy is weak

Stage breakdowns — how many minutes of deep or REM sleep you had — should be treated as estimates. Validation studies against polysomnography generally show moderate agreement at best, especially for distinguishing light from deep sleep. A single night's stage chart is not a clinical result and should not drive decisions.

Blood oxygen features and apnea

Some devices estimate overnight oxygen variation and may flag possible breathing disturbances. These features can be a useful prompt to seek evaluation, but they do not diagnose sleep apnea. Diagnosis requires a home sleep apnea test or in-lab study ordered by a clinician.

Orthosomnia: when tracking makes sleep worse

Clinicians have described a pattern where anxiety about achieving a perfect sleep score itself causes insomnia. If you find yourself checking the app before you have fully woken, feeling worse after a poor score, or changing plans because of a number, take a break from tracking for a few weeks. How you feel and function is the more valid outcome.

Using data well

Look at weekly and monthly averages rather than individual nights. Pick one variable to work on at a time — bedtime consistency is usually the highest-yield. Run simple experiments: two weeks with no alcohol, or a fixed wake time, and compare averages. Pair the device with a short subjective diary, which captures what the sensor cannot.

FAQ

Which metric matters most? Bedtime and wake-time consistency, followed by total sleep time. Should I buy a tracker to fix my sleep? Only if you will act on trends; the basics work without one. Can I show tracker data to my doctor? It can be a helpful conversation starter, but clinical decisions rely on validated testing.

Bottom line

Treat your tracker as a trend instrument, not a sleep lab. Use it to build consistency, ignore single-night stage charts, and stop using it if it is making you anxious about sleep.
